From 794914353d24c2a32703f8a5c7da24fcc73ce149 Mon Sep 17 00:00:00 2001 From: Matthew Chen Date: Thu, 11 Oct 2018 13:07:25 -0400 Subject: [PATCH] Respond to CR. --- SignalMessaging/profiles/OWSProfileManager.m | 10 ++++------ 1 file changed, 4 insertions(+), 6 deletions(-) diff --git a/SignalMessaging/profiles/OWSProfileManager.m b/SignalMessaging/profiles/OWSProfileManager.m index 6751f3ec2..9143ac88e 100644 --- a/SignalMessaging/profiles/OWSProfileManager.m +++ b/SignalMessaging/profiles/OWSProfileManager.m @@ -469,10 +469,9 @@ typedef void (^ProfileManagerFailureBlock)(NSError *error); OWSLogInfo(@"successfully uploaded avatar with key: %@", formKey); successBlock(formKey); } - failure:^(NSURLSessionDataTask *_Nullable uploadTask, NSError *_Nonnull error) { + failure:^(NSURLSessionDataTask *_Nullable uploadTask, NSError *error) { OWSLogError(@"uploading avatar failed with error: %@", error); - return failureBlock( - OWSErrorWithCodeDescription(OWSErrorCodeAvatarUploadFailed, @"Avatar upload failed.")); + return failureBlock(error); }]; } failure:^(NSURLSessionDataTask *task, NSError *error) { @@ -483,8 +482,7 @@ typedef void (^ProfileManagerFailureBlock)(NSError *error); } OWSLogError(@"Failed to get profile avatar upload form: %@", error); - return failureBlock( - OWSErrorWithCodeDescription(OWSErrorCodeAvatarUploadFailed, @"Avatar upload failed.")); + return failureBlock(error); }]; }); } @@ -718,7 +716,7 @@ typedef void (^ProfileManagerFailureBlock)(NSError *error); if ([error isKindOfClass:[NSError class]]) { failure(error); } else { - failure(OWSErrorWithCodeDescription(OWSErrorCodeProfileUpdateFailed, @"Profile key rotation failed.")); + failure(OWSErrorMakeAssertionError(@"Profile key rotation failure missing error.")); } }); [promise retainUntilComplete];